Interns Interns leaving Gabriella Johnson, Financial Manager Gabriella has held the position as the Financial Manager since the beginning of July. Budgeting events, accounting, preparing board meetings and planning events have been some of her work duties during the internship. Gabriella holds a B.Sc. degree in Real Estate and Finance and during this internship she has been able to apply her theoretical knowledge and has also gained a lot of new knowledge regarding the work in a non- profit organization. Thanks to the close work with Elisabeth, she has also developed her knowledge about the marketing efforts of a company. Furthermore, the internship has given her invaluable experience of working with an international business in the U.S. Before this internship, Gabriella had been in the U.S. several times but had no connection to Philadelphia. The city has now become one of her favorites in the States, thanks to all the amazing restaurants and the fact that Philadelphia is a small big city. With many unforgettable memories and a broader network, she now moves back to Sweden and hopes she will be back in the U.S. very soon. Elisabeth Avrotin, Marketing Manager Elisabeth has held the position as the Marketing Manager from the beginning of July 2017 until the beginning of January 2018. Her time at the Chamber has been very exciting and she has gained insightful knowledge of the American business culture and how to facilitate trade between Sweden and the U.S. Working at SACC Philadelphia has also given Elisabeth great networking opportunities, which she hopes to use in the near future. Philadelphia is a great city and Elisabeth has enjoyed her time here a lot. Together with Gabriella, she has visited many restaurants, museums and other interesting places in the city. Elisabeth is happy she got the chance to explore Philadelphia and she will definitely be back soon. As for now, she is going home to Stockholm to finish her M.Sc. in Marketing and continue working at the PR- firm Prime & United Minds. Page 18
